THE CHALLENGES

Solis by Astina is a multi-level luxury residential development at 10–16 John Tipping Grove, Penrith — a sequence of suspended concrete slabs rising above basement parking and a ground-level plane. For the formwork contractor, every slab pour had to be carried on a temporary works system engineered to take the full weight of wet concrete, formwork and construction live loads, then back-propped so those loads could be shed safely through slabs that had not yet reached full design strength.

With levels poured in staged zones on a live, access-constrained site, the temporary works had to be documented clearly enough for crews to erect and strike it correctly pour after pour — and independently verified at each stage before concrete was placed. An error in the propping or back-propping arrangement risks slab overload, excessive deflection or collapse, so the system demanded rigorous design and disciplined on-site checking.

OUR APPROACH

Metric Engineering was engaged by the formwork contractor to deliver the project's temporary works design. We produced formwork and back-propping drawings for the basement, ground floor and suspended levels — setting out bearer and joist layouts, prop and frame spacings, and back-propping arrangements designed to AS 3610 and AS 3600, with construction loads assessed against the strength gain of the slabs below.

Each deck was engineered as a complete load path — from the formwork face, through the timber bearers and joists, into the shoring frames and adjustable props, and down to a supporting slab checked for the imposed back-prop loads. Layouts were detailed for real site conditions and staged zone pours, so the same system could be struck, cycled and re-propped efficiently as construction climbed the building.

Through construction, Metric carried out level-by-level, zone-by-zone formwork inspections ahead of each pour, verifying that the erected formwork and propping matched the design before sign-off. Every inspection was documented and certified, giving the builder and formwork contractor a clear, auditable record that the temporary works were compliant at each stage.

THE RESULTS

Metric's temporary works design and stage-by-stage certification gave the site a clearly documented, code-compliant propping system for every slab pour — reducing construction risk, keeping the pour cycle moving, and providing an auditable trail of formwork sign-offs from basement to roof. The completed development, now delivered as Solis by Astina, stands on a structure that was formed safely and efficiently, level by level.
